I have the following image (original image is .tif format)

Now, I would like to recolor it, that I don't have single color pixels anymore. I imagine something like the following:
assess a 10 x 10 pixel wide tile (or any other size), add only the non-zero color values and devide it by the number of non-zero values in this 10 x 10 tile to get the average pixel color. Than, recolor this 10 x 10 tile with the average pixel color. And than repeat this, with all possible not overlapping tiles of the image.
